From roughly 1988-1993, a CD came in what was called a long box, 6” x 12”, cardboard and hollow. The long box was a throwaway vessel that carried the smaller passenger of the jewel box-encased CD. The long box was a transitional design, fashioned so that two of them could stand up, side by side, in the same bins that once held vinyl records (12” x 12”).

(Wikipedia Excerpts)  Blues Traveler is an American rock band that formed in Princeton, New Jersey in 1987. They are known for their extensive use of segues in live performances and were considered a key part of the re-emerging jam band scene of the 1990s. 1992, the group founded the H.O.R.D.E. festival as an alternative to others such as Lollapalooza, along with other bands such as Phish and Spin Doctors.

Blues Traveler released their self-titled debut album in 1990.  Travelers & Thieves (for sale in this listing) is Blues Traveler's second album, released on A&M Records in 1991. On iTunes the album is listed only as Travelers due to the full name being split across two drawings.  On this long box version "Travelers" appears on the front cover and "Thieves" is on the back cover.  The full title "Travelers & Thieves" appears on all four edges/spines followed by the catalog number.

The liner notes include a poem titled "Of Travelers & Thieves," written by Jonathan Sheehan, brother of bassist Bobby Sheehan.  Guest performers on the album include Gregg Allman (Hammond B3 and vocals on "Mountain Cry") and Chris Barron (backing vocals on "All in the Groove").

Around this time, the mainstream national audience was exposed to Blues Traveler by television host David Letterman, who has introduced them as "his favorite band". The band has since made more appearances on The Late Show than any musical artist. Letterman's band leader Paul Shaffer has played on a number of Blues Traveler recordings.
